Byzantine Gold Treasure Reveals Elite Passengers on Ancient Shipwreck

A golden undersea treasure trove off the Croatian island of Mljet is rewriting what historians know about Byzantine seafaring — and proving that this was no ordinary shipwreck.

After 11 years of painstaking research spanning nine archaeological campaigns, the Croatian Conservation Institute, working with researchers from Stanford University, has revealed the extraordinary cargo recovered from a 7th- or 8th-century Byzantine shipwreck resting on the floor of the Adriatic Sea.

Among the finds are more than 600 grams (1.3 pounds) of gold, an amount researchers believe represents the largest gold haul ever recovered from a shipwreck in the Mediterranean region.

The glittering collection includes gold coins, luxurious belt buckles adorned with rubies, emeralds and pearls, and what may be the site's most revealing artifact — a gold signet ring bearing the image of an emperor from the Heraclius dynasty.

That single ring transformed archaeologists' understanding of the vessel.

According to the Croatian Conservation Institute, a signet ring of this type could only have belonged to someone in the empire's highest military or government ranks who was authorized to seal imperial documents. Researchers believe it may have been either a diplomatic gift or the personal possession of a senior Byzantine official. Together with the lavish belt fittings, it strongly suggests the ship was transporting a high-ranking dignitary and entourage, rather than serving as a routine merchant vessel.

The discovery is especially significant because fully investigated shipwrecks from this pivotal era are exceedingly rare. During the late 7th and early 8th centuries, the Byzantine Empire was undergoing profound political and territorial changes, making every surviving artifact a valuable historical clue.

The discovery offers a fascinating glimpse into the opulence of the Byzantine elite. The exquisitely crafted gold signet ring and gemstone-studded belt fittings demonstrate that, even more than 1,300 years ago, fine jewelry served not only as adornment, but also as unmistakable symbols of authority, privilege and imperial power.

The ship's cargo wasn't limited to luxury items. Archaeologists also recovered amphorae, merchant scales, ivory tokens and ceramic vessels, indicating the vessel combined diplomatic travel with commercial trade. Researchers believe the ship likely sank while attempting to seek shelter in Polače Bay, a protected harbor that had served mariners for centuries during storms.

Justin Leidwanger, professor of archaeology at Stanford University, described the site as one of the most important shipwrecks of its period because it offers fresh insight into how Mediterranean trade routes functioned during the transition from the late Roman Empire to the medieval world.
